Fourteen new fluorine-containing chlorothalonil derivatives were synthesized by using intermediate derivatization method (IDM) in order to discover novel antifungal compounds for controlling corn rust. The structures of synthesized compounds were confirmed by 1H NMR, 13C NMR, 19F NMR, elemental analysis, HRMS and X-ray. The bioassay results indicated that compound 2,4,5-trichloro-6-(2,6-dichloro-4-[trifluoromethyl]phenylamino)isophthalonitrile (3j, Rn is 2,6-Cl2-4-CF3) had the optimal structure with best fungicidal activity against corn rust (98%, 70% controls) at 25 and 6.25 mg/L concentration, respectively, much better than chlorothalonil and fluazinam, highlighting the importance of trifluoromethyl group on 4-position of benzene ring. The structure-activity relationship of the synthesized compounds was discussed as well.
